Mountain Warehouse Amersham

Currently, Mountain Warehouse operates 12 stores near Amersham, Buckinghamshire. Here you will find a list of Mountain Warehouse branches in the area.

Mountain Warehouse Henley on Thames

Open: 10:30 am - 4:30 pm15.92 mi

Mountain Warehouse Thame

Open: 10:00 am - 4:00 pm16.67 mi

Mountain Warehouse Comet Way

Open: 11:00 am - 5:00 pm16.79 mi

Mountain Warehouse The Lexicon Shopping Centre, Bracknell

Open: 10:00 am - 5:00 pm18.92 mi

Mountain Warehouse London, Chiswick

Open: 11:00 am - 5:00 pm19.58 mi

Mountain Warehouse Richmond, George Street

Open: 11:00 am - 5:00 pm19.70 mi